Top Handling Upgrades for C8 Corvette E-Ray

1. Performance Suspension Kits

One of the most impactful upgrades for the C8 Corvette E-Ray is a performance suspension kit. This includes upgraded springs, dampers, and sway bars designed to enhance handling characteristics.

  • Adjustable Coilovers: Allow for customization of ride height and damping settings.
  • Upgraded Sway Bars: Reduce body roll during cornering, improving stability.

2. High-Performance Tires

Investing in high-performance tires is crucial for maximizing grip and handling. The right tires can make a significant difference in cornering capabilities and overall performance.

  • Summer Tires: Provide better traction in warm conditions, ideal for track use.
  • Track-Specific Tires: Designed for maximum grip and performance on the racetrack.

3. Upgraded Brake System

A high-performance brake system is essential for any track-focused vehicle. Upgrading the brakes enhances stopping power and reduces brake fade during intense driving sessions.

  • Performance Brake Pads: Offer better bite and fade resistance compared to stock pads.
  • Upgraded Rotors: Lightweight, slotted, or drilled rotors improve cooling and performance.

4. Lightweight Wheels

Switching to lightweight wheels can improve handling by reducing unsprung weight. This upgrade enhances acceleration, braking, and cornering performance.

  • Forged Aluminum Wheels: Offer strength without the weight, improving overall performance.
  • Wider Wheels: Allow for wider tires, increasing grip and stability.

5. Chassis Bracing

Chassis bracing helps to reduce flex in the vehicle’s frame, improving handling and stability. This upgrade is particularly beneficial for track-focused driving.

  • Front and Rear Strut Braces: Enhance rigidity and improve steering response.
  • Underbody Bracing: Reduces chassis flex, providing a more stable platform during cornering.

6. Alignment and Tuning

After making upgrades, a proper alignment is crucial to ensure that the vehicle handles as intended. Professional tuning can optimize the setup for track performance.

  • Corner Balancing: Ensures even weight distribution for improved handling.
  • Camber and Toe Adjustments: Fine-tune handling characteristics for better cornering performance.
